![]() |
![]() |
![]() |
![]() |
![]() |
![]() |
![]() |
![]() |
![]() |
![]() |
![]() |
![]() |
![]() |
![]() |
![]() |
![]() |
![]() |
2014年9月全國二級(jí)VFP考試操作題真題1 |
一、基本操作題 在考生目錄下完成下列操作: 1.從數(shù)據(jù)庫stock中移去表stock_fk(不是刪除)。 2.將自由表stock_name添加到數(shù)據(jù)庫中。 3.為表stock_sl建立一個(gè)主索引,索引名和索引表達(dá)式均為“股票代碼”。 4.為stock_name表的股票代碼字段設(shè)置有效性規(guī)則,“規(guī)則”是: left(股票代碼,1)=”6”,錯(cuò)誤提示信息是“股票代碼的第一位必須是6”。 二、簡單應(yīng)用題 在考生目錄下完成如下簡單應(yīng)用: 1.用SQL語句完成下列操作:列出所有贏利(現(xiàn)價(jià)大于買入價(jià))的股票簡稱、現(xiàn)價(jià)、買入價(jià)和持有數(shù)量,并將檢索結(jié)果按持有數(shù)量降序排序存儲(chǔ)于表stock_temp中。 2.使用一對(duì)多報(bào)表向?qū)Ы?bào)表。要求:父表為stock_name,子表為stock_sl,從父表中選擇字段“股票簡稱”;從子表中選擇全部字段;兩個(gè)表通過“股票代碼”建立聯(lián)系;按股票代碼升序排序;報(bào)表標(biāo)題為“股票持有情況”;生成的報(bào)表文件名為stock_report。然后用報(bào)表設(shè)計(jì)器打開生成的文件stock_report.frx進(jìn)行修改,將標(biāo)題區(qū)中顯示的當(dāng)前日期移到頁注腳區(qū)顯示,使得在頁注腳區(qū)能夠顯示當(dāng)前日期。 三、綜合應(yīng)用題 設(shè)計(jì)名為mystock的表單(控件名,文件名均為mystock)。表單的標(biāo)題為“股票持有情況”。表單中有兩個(gè)文本框(Text1和Text2)和三個(gè)命令按鈕“查詢”(名稱為Command1)、“退出”(名稱為Command2)和“清空”(名稱為Command3)。 運(yùn)行表單時(shí),在文本框Text1中輸入某一股票的漢語拼音,然后單擊“查詢”按鈕,則Text2中會(huì)顯示出相應(yīng)股票的持有數(shù)量,并計(jì)算相應(yīng)股票的浮虧信息追加到stock_fk表中,計(jì)算公式是浮虧金額=(現(xiàn)價(jià)-買入價(jià))*持有數(shù)量。 單擊“清空”按鈕物理刪除表stock_fk的全部記錄。 單擊“退出”按鈕關(guān)閉表單。 請(qǐng)運(yùn)行表單,單擊“清空”按鈕后,依次查詢qlsh、shjc和bggf的股票持有數(shù)量,同時(shí)計(jì)算浮虧金額。
|